GMED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2019 in Review

259 of the 4,604 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Globus Medical (GMED) for Q2 2019, worth a combined $2.88B — down 13% from $3.3B a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 41 funds closed out of GMED and 34 opened new positions — a net loss of 7 holders — while 84 trimmed existing stakes and 100 added.

The largest buyer was Janus Henderson Group, adding an estimated $122M. The largest seller was Victory Capital Management, exiting entirely with an estimated $45.6M sold.
